欢迎来到天天文库
浏览记录
ID:4185829
大小:214.28 KB
页数:12页
时间:2017-11-29
《让我们开始extjs之旅》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、第2章 让我们开始ExtJS之旅2.1认识ExtJS的开发包开始ExtJS之旅的第一步是要获得开发包,可以从官方网站www.ExtJS.com下载,以保证获得最新版本。其下载地址是http://www.ExtJS.com/download,下载成功后的开发包是ExtJS-2.0.2.zip,有6.08MB大。不过不用担心,这个包并不是ExtJS程序真正运行时必须要载入的,真正必须要载入的只是这个包中的2个js和1个CSS文件,共665KB。其实这个包中包括了很多有用的资源,在正式开始开发之前,有必要对这个包中的相关资源
2、有所了解。图2-1就是解开ExtJS-2.0.2.zip之后的文件目录结构。ExtJS-2.0.2开发包中有8个文件子包与8个文件,下面分别对这些资源进行简单介绍。•adapter目录中放置的是ExtJS的核心代码与底层库(如jquery和prototype)的适配器,ExtJS是可以做到动态切换底层库的,关键就在这里了。•air包含了ExtJS以air进行改进的代码库,还有以该代码库实现的任务管理实例。•build目录是ExtJS压缩后的代码,经过压缩的代码体积更小,加载更快。•docs中当然是ExtJS的文档了,其
3、中最重要的是ExtJS的API,这是开发ExtJS程序过程中的法宝。•examples中是官方的演示示例,这里是初学者最好的学习乐园,通过对这些演示示列的熟悉,就能很图2-1ExtJS开发包的文件目录结构快掌握ExtJS开发。•package中是ExtJS各种组件的代码库,当使用到相关组件时,就需要引入这个目录中的组件实现库。•resources中是ExtJS要用到的图片文件与样式表文件,ExtJS引以为傲的漂亮外观就全部由这个目录中的文件所控制。•source目录是相对build目录而言的,就是build目录相关文件
4、压缩处理前的版本。•.htaccess文件是访问控制文件,ExtJS利用该文件实现了对CSS、html和js文件的保护,防止被直接下载,当然这个需要服务器的支持。•CHANGES.txt文件是版本的修正列表文件。•ext-all.js文件是ExtJS的核心库,是必须要引入的。14第2章•ext-all-debug.js文件是ext-all.js的调试版,在调试时需要使用到调试版。•ext-core.js文件也是ExtJS的核心库,是必须要引入的。•ext-core-debug.js文件是ext-core.js的调试版。
5、•INCLUDE_ORDER.txt文件对使用不同的底层库在引入js文件上的顺序说明。•LICENSE.txt文件是ExtJS的使用许可文件。2.2也从Helloworld开始几乎所有开发语言的学习都是从Helloworld开始的。因为Helloworld虽然只是简单的输出,但是它所要求的开发与运行环境和工作流程与写一个大型软件所要求的环境和流程没有太大的差别。所以说重要的并不在显示或者输出Helloworld,而是为成功显示或者输出这个Helloworld所经历的过程。对于ExtJS的学习,可以从Helloworld
6、开始,熟悉其开发与运行过程。ExtJS只是一套用JavaScript实现的界面层组件,所以在没有与服务器要进行数据交换的情况下,并不需要服务器的支持,在本地浏览器中就能运行得很好。第一个ExtJS程序Helloworld不需要同服务器端进行通信,只要使用简单的HTML文件即可。如代码2-1所示。代码2-1ExtJS的Helloworld
7、resources/css/ext-all.css"/>代码2-1对于写过JavaScript程序的人来说并不难懂。除了HTML的框架之外,引入了1个CSS文件
此文档下载收益归作者所有